I just went to the Kerio site to download a copy of KPF 4.22 but noticed that by the end
of the month it is expected to be in the hands of Sunbelt Software. Their web site says
that a free basic version of KPF will be retained, but....


Still, if KPF is accessible it is probably the best option currently available.
